The Young, The Old and the Ladies (another tourney by Josh Terwilleger and Crossover Disc Golf).  Worked for us since I'm masters age and Danny is still "the young" so I played MP40 and he played rec.  Smaller field today since Josh had another tournament the day before at Burg, but that was just fine with us.  Course was not crowded and we had a good time.

I threw with Josh & Darryl Whitaker and Danny threw with a couple juniors -- Kyle & Elijah Reynolds and also Nick Toyeas.  We both really enjoyed our cards.  It was a good day for golf . . . it was too warm and humid but it's summertime so what do you expect?

Danny threw great for him and scored his highest rated round yet (886).  Throwing league every week has really helped him improve his game.  He ended up third in rec and won some Crossover Cash that he used on a disc, chalk bag and hat.

I threw kind of poorly for two-thirds of the round (26 hole round) and then when I stepped up to Hole 21 -- the island hole -- I aced it.  I was stunned when it happened . . . it was a good throw and tracking toward the basket but I was still surprised.  Was an in-the-air ace and it stuck solidly.   My first tournament ace.  Nick on Danny's card also had an ace so we split the ace fund . . . and Hole 21 was a CTP so I collected that too.

Anyway, after a very mediocre round up to that point the ace woke me up and I managed three more birdies on the next five holes so I ended up going 5-down over the last six holes which got to me 4-under on the day.

Which ended up being "important" because I ended up beating Danny by only two strokes.  He's catching up to me a bunch this year.  Anyway, I was pretty happy to salvage a 900+ round from the mess that had been my round up until the ace.
